How Common Is The Last Name Slepian? popularity and diffusion

The last name is the 698,433rd most commonly held family name at a global level. It is borne by approximately 1 in 17,269,066 people. Slepian occurs mostly in The Americas, where 78 percent of Slepian reside; 77 percent reside in North America and 77 percent reside in Anglo-North America.

The surname is most widespread in The United States, where it is held by 314 people, or 1 in 1,154,328. In The United States Slepian is mostly concentrated in: New York, where 31 percent are found, Pennsylvania, where 14 percent are found and New Jersey, where 11 percent are found. Not including The United States this surname is found in 12 countries. It also occurs in Israel, where 18 percent are found and Canada, where 2 percent are found.
